Man arrested after a traffic stop Saturday in Elkhart

A man in Elkhart was arrested after a traffic stop Saturday night.

Police were near the intersection of Main Street and Marion Street when they saw a man on motorcycle in which his battery had fallen off of the bike.

Upon pulling over the man, they learned he had an active warrant. That’s when officers say the suspect, 27-year-old Zachary Loomis allegedly cut one of the officer’s thumb and even grabbed for the officer’s taser.

After police restrained Loomis, they found methamphetamine and marijuana on him.

Loomis was taken into custody on a list of preliminary charges, including battery against a public officer, possession of meth, marijuana and paraphernalia.
